Operations Supervisor

3 months ago


Alvin, United States Arrow Transportation Systems Inc. Full time

Overview:
**A Career with a Growing Company**

Over 100 years in business, the Arrow Group of Companies has led the way in developing service focused transportation solutions by working with a broad range of customers, hauling a wider variety of products, and expanding our presence throughout Canada and the United States. Arrow is an industry leading transportation, distribution and materials handling organization.

At our Alvin Reload facility, we handle lumber and steele products.. We provide custom handling, inventory management and other services. We are a small but mighty division and backed by an organization that employs over 1300 people. Our growth is unprecedented and there are several opportunities for advancement within our organization.

**Responsibilities**:
Under the direction of the Regional Manager, the Operations Supervisor role is to assist in the planning, organization, coordination and implementation of the divisions and customers operational goals, policies and procedures. The Operations Supervisor will oversee all responsibilities including but not limited to, customers, staff, equipment & inventory within the operation. The supervisor will operate various equipment (forklifts & loaders) along side operators, laborer's as needed while continuing to oversee and supervise the resources necessary (people and equipment) to meet customer & maintenance commitments, while ensuring a safe, productive, compliant and cost efficient operation. The supervisor is responsible for building and maintaining a team of motivated, efficient and productive employees and to coordinate their efforts through strong leadership, coaching, support, and direction.

Major Responsibilities:

- Works with and oversees the assignment and scheduling of yard staff and ensures a plan is in place should there be a short or long-term shortfall or fluctuations in volume and/or if staff is absent.
- Communicates with the primary customers to exchange information, coordinate activities and resolve issues, concerns and questions regarding shipments via truck, rail or yard services, customer site and/or driver issues.
- Responsible for accurately receiving and shipping all inbound/outbound orders.
- Implement and maintain invoicing procedures and controls to ensure accurate and appropriate inventory levels at all times using Arrow’s system “Inventory Manager”.
- Counts and reconciles inventory on a regular basis (tbd by Division as to daily, weekly etc..) and communicates same with customer as required. Ensures inventory integrity is met and maintained while in the possession of the division.
- Trains, supervises, motivates and evaluates the performance of assigned staff. Is responsible for terminations and disciplinary action as well as commendation of assigned staff as required.
- Schedules and coordinates required employee training and orientation.
- Ensures that all relevant and appropriate safety regulations and employment laws, rules and regulations as well as Arrow processes are followed when managing staff i.e. all safety procedures, onboarding, supervising, scheduling and discipline.
- Assists in maintaining thorough personnel record to satisfy legal as well as Arrow requirements.
- Continuously surveys the existing program for safety and cost improvement opportunities and advises the manager of ways to improve current systems.
- Assists in the development, change to or implementation of policy and process improvement.
- Responsible for the accurate and timely delivery of all paper work and required computer transmissions.
- Receives and responds to yard incidents and conducts and reports internal investigations; gathers information, takes photos and assists staff.
- Ensures that all relevant aspects of the Reload “Operations Excellence Manual” are followed.
- Other duties as assigned by the manager.
